DATA SHEET SE2598L: 2.4 GHz Power Amplifier with Power Detector Preliminary Information Applications     Product Description The SE2598L is a 2.4 GHz power amplifier designed for use in the 2.4 GHz ISM band for wireless LAN applications. The device incorporates a power detector for closed loop monitoring of the output power. DSSS 2.4 GHz WLAN (IEEE802.11b) OFDM 2.4 GHz WLAN (IEEE802.11g) OFDM 2.4 GHz WLAN (IEEE802.11n) Access Points, PCMCIA, PC cards The SE2598L includes a digital enable control for device on/off control.
